I'm having an issue with modding and freezing. I've noticed that whenever my save file reaches a size of 1 MB the game freezes and I won't be able to start it up again until I remove the save file from my hard drive. Rehashing and Resigning doesn't seem to solve this issue. Does anyone know of a possible fix? I know the obvious solution would be to not make that many saves but if I can solve this issue I'd like to.
EDIT: My problem is exactly the same as the problem ImplodingGoat and a few others have had earlier in this thread. I've gotten this freeze/corrupted issue on two different modded careers. The thing is I've only modded credits and elements so I don't think the actual modding is causing this problem. Most of the people that have reported this problem all mentioned that they completed a good portion of the game, so it's more than possible for them to have 1 MB worth of save files in their careers. So has anyone who's modded been able to make it to 1 MB without this freezing issue?
Deleting the Corrupted Career...
METHOD A: Done through the 360. Get into the memory settings on your 360 (its under the systems menu) and manually delete the career save, they should have dates and names to distinguish them and the one you want will be the last one you played (ie the most recently saved) which is the file the game is getting hung up on since the game tries to access it so it will be ready at the main menu under "resume". This will entail losing the entire career, not just your most recent save. But the next time you try to play ME2 the game will go to the main menu and you will be able to start a new career or access all your other careers aside from the corrupted one you had to delete.
METHOD B: Using Xport 360 software.. Plug the 360 harddrive into your PC open it using Xport 360 and delete the most recent saved career. Plug the hard drive back into your 360 and fire up ME2. The Main Menu should load.
Attempt to Salvage the Career
METHOD C: Done through the PC. Put the career file you last accessed on the 360 on your PC and open the career using modio and manually delete the most recent save in the career. Rehash the file and Resign. Delete the career you most recently used from the 360 and Inject the modded career back into the 360 hard drive. Start up ME2 and see if you can get to the main menu screen. If you can, click load save and pick the most recent save in the career that you were last playing. It it loads then you got rid of the corrupt save and the career should be playable. Be advised though the time I did this the career I reverted to an older save on also became corrupted after I played further on and saved a few times, so it may be necessary to mod the save file back to a less modified state by taking out things you may have added to your weapon inventory or the like.
Hope that helps.
PS: I still had the career that became corrupted saved on my hard drive for reference and I noticed it was 972 KB which is much closer to 1MB than most of my other saves. Its possible that if you cross 1MB the game can no longer recognize the save which would make since because after I saved a few more times on that career that had been corrupted, that might have pushed the file size over the 1MB threshold. If that's so you might need to revert to a save file that is considerably smaller start playing again then hope for the best.
